use std::str::FromStr;
use apalis_core::backend::{Backend, Metrics, StatType, Statistic};
use crate::{PostgresStorage, error::Error};
struct StatisticRow {
priority: Option<i32>,
r#type: Option<String>,
statistic: Option<String>,
value: Option<f32>,
}
impl<Args> Metrics for PostgresStorage<Args>
where
PostgresStorage<Args>: Backend<Error = Error>,
{
fn global(&self) -> impl Future<Output = Result<Vec<Statistic>, Self::Error>> + Send {
let pool = self.persistence.pool.clone();
async move {
let rec = sqlx::query_file_as!(StatisticRow, "queries/backend/overview.sql")
.fetch_all(&pool)
.await?
.into_iter()
.map(|r| Statistic {
priority: Some(r.priority.unwrap_or_default() as u64),
stat_type: StatType::from_str(&r.r#type.unwrap_or_default())
.unwrap_or_default(),
title: r.statistic.unwrap_or_default(),
value: r.value.unwrap_or_default().to_string(),
})
.collect();
Ok(rec)
}
}
fn fetch_by_queue(&self) -> impl Future<Output = Result<Vec<Statistic>, Self::Error>> + Send {
let pool = self.persistence.pool.clone();
let queue_id = self.persistence.config.queue.to_string();
async move {
let rec = sqlx::query_file_as!(
StatisticRow,
"queries/backend/overview_by_queue.sql",
queue_id
)
.fetch_all(&pool)
.await?
.into_iter()
.map(|r| Statistic {
priority: Some(r.priority.unwrap_or_default() as u64),
stat_type: StatType::from_str(&r.r#type.unwrap_or_default()).unwrap_or_default(),
title: r.statistic.unwrap_or_default(),
value: r.value.unwrap_or_default().to_string(),
})
.collect();
Ok(rec)
}
}
}
